About Anne Blevins
Anne Blevins is a scholar working on Pulmonary and Respiratory Medicine, Oncology, Epidemiology, Infectious Diseases and Surgery, having authored 12 papers that have together received 598 indexed citations. Recurring topics across this work include Neutropenia and Cancer Infections (4 papers), Pneumocystis jirovecii pneumonia detection and treatment (3 papers), Wound Healing and Treatments (2 papers), Antifungal resistance and susceptibility (2 papers), Fungal Infections and Studies (2 papers), Pressure Ulcer Prevention and Management (2 papers),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(2 papers) and Diphtheria, Corynebacterium, and Tetanus (2 papers). The work is most often cited by research in Microbiology (95 citations), Clinical Biochemistry (66 citations), Infectious Diseases (174 citations), Epidemiology (293 citations) and Small Animals (65 citations). Anne Blevins has collaborated with scholars based in United States and Germany. Frequent co-authors include Donald Armstrong, Lowell S. Young, Richard D. Meyer, Phillip Lieberman, Constance Cirrincione, Michelle E. White, Arthur E. Brown, Ming-Yuan Chou, Judith J. Stellar and Alice King. Their work appears in journals such as Cancer, Annals of the New York Academy of Sciences, The American Journal of Medicine, Mycoses and Medical Clinics of North America.
